📘 Walrus Protocol and the Future of Decentralized Data Availability

As blockchain applications grow more complex, reliable data storage and availability are becoming just as important as smart contracts themselves. @walrusprotocol is emerging as an innovative solution in this space by focusing on decentralized, scalable, and secure data availability for Web3 applications.

Walrus Protocol is designed to help developers store and access large amounts of data without relying on centralized servers. This is a critical step toward true decentralization, as many blockchains and dApps still depend on off-chain or centralized storage providers. With $WAL, the network incentivizes participants to contribute storage and maintain data integrity, strengthening the ecosystem as a whole.

One of the key strengths of Walrus is its emphasis on efficiency and resilience. By distributing data across multiple nodes, the protocol reduces single points of failure while ensuring that applications can retrieve information quickly when needed. This makes it especially valuable for NFTs, gaming, DeFi analytics, and data-heavy decentralized applications.
